There are two examinations rooms A and B. If 10 students are sent from A to B, then the number of students in each room is the same. If 20 candidates are sent from B to A, then the number of students in A is double the number of students in B. The number of students in room A is:

\\ Let \ the \ number \ of \ students \ in \ rooms \ $A$ \ and \ $B$ \ be\ $x$\ and \ $y$ \ respectively.\\ \\ Then, $x-10=y+10 \Rightarrow x-y=20 \ldots$ and $x+20=2(y-20) \Rightarrow x-2 y=-60 \ldots$ \\ \\ Solving (i) and (ii) \ we \ get:\ $x=100, y=80$ \\ \\ $\therefore$ \ The \ required \ answer \ $A=100$
